For professionals working with key intermediates, understanding the specific properties and purity levels of compounds like 4-Nitroanthranilic Acid (CAS: 619-17-0) is fundamental. This compound, also known as 2-Amino-4-nitrobenzoic acid, is a critical component in various industrial applications, from pharmaceuticals to dyes.

The physical and chemical properties of 4-Nitroanthranilic Acid, such as its melting point (around 257 °C with decomposition), solubility profile, and stability, are essential data points for chemists. Its orange crystalline powder form and specific reactivity, influenced by the nitro and amino groups, dictate how it can be effectively utilized in complex reaction pathways.
